Transaction 8937e21ffb8066e8b1acd095c2776d2055446e1178667ee6f7f3a4c431e42538

1 Input
2 Outputs
  • 8937e21ffb8066e8b1acd095c2776d2055446e1178667ee6f7f3a4c431e42538:0
  • value  251116
    address  39raiYBGeBPVv7LUabtvoNsRzhqzn6q5as
  • 8937e21ffb8066e8b1acd095c2776d2055446e1178667ee6f7f3a4c431e42538:1
  • value  361860
    address  bc1q3ej8734gpjfczjy5rt6kfk0qe7p3jvluh3040s